Output e9b6dd0a1ff16dc00530e6f701eae9e19a290a24bfe7c75142db96078b6c7824:13

value
280825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b9aac31f59fa89d6c2eb33ed570c671fd6515a5 OP_EQUAL
address
3Fsmx7xLYsvhuWq5ymXB7tujqsrH7dBuWt
transaction
e9b6dd0a1ff16dc00530e6f701eae9e19a290a24bfe7c75142db96078b6c7824
confirmations
203459
spent
true